Going Green with Quartz Kitchen Countertops Environmentalism spawned eco-friendly home construction, and that involves green kitchen countertops. Going green, however, reduces one’s range of options, and no one wants recycled bottles or plastic on the countertop. The challenge is to come up with good-looking countertops without harming the environment in any way. One of the materials that can satisfy such a stringent need is quartz. What makes quartz eco-friendly? Different kitchen countertop builders offer slightly different quartz countertops, but these are usually made of natural quartz. Rocks used in industries, such as glass making, are not used completely. Instead, they have remnants from which quartz is extracted. Thus, production of quartz involves use of industrial leftovers, which might only be wasted. Quartz isn’t directly obtained through mining or quarrying. Is quartz a good material for countertops? The making of quartz kitchen countertops requires tedious engineering to come up with a tough material. The material should withstand heat and friction. Hence, countertop manufacturers adhere to standard procedure in the manufacturing process. The outcome should be a durable, nonporous material. Kitchen counters should be made of a material that doesn’t absorb liquids, because it’s inevitable to spill milk or coffee on the countertop. Surfaces should also be made smooth for easy cleanup, and so kitchen countertops should be smooth both for aesthetic appeal and for sanitation purposes. It’s hard for mold and bacteria to thrive on smooth surfaces. There are no tiny holes or crevices for them to thrive in. Microorganisms love moist surfaces—and your kitchen counters are likely to get damp any time of the day. Smooth surfaces dry faster than rough ones. Is warranty important? Just like in buying furniture, ordering kitchen countertops means you have to ensure warranty. Manufacturers usually issue a 10-year or 15-year warranty for these products. Warranty may include replacement and repair so long as defects are not due to kitchen accidents or mishandling. Is it important to choose among designs? Of course, quartz countertops come in many designs and colors. Careful choosing ensures getting the right countertop to match the kitchen theme. Kitchen countertops should be included in the overall kitchen construction plan so that everything is in harmony. Be careful when choosing countertops with patterns. The patterns should match your overall kitchen design. Clumsy choosing leads to interior design fiasco. Taking Care of Your Countertops Quartz countertops need no more maintenance than other types of countertops. Basically, you still have to clean surfaces. As much as possible, avoid staining surfaces.
